Here are the roles and their respective percentages in 3D printed building maintenance strategies, providing a clear picture of the career advancement opportunities available in this cutting-edge field. 1. 3D Printing Engineer (25%): With the rapid growth of 3D printing technology, the demand for skilled professionals in this area is high.
They are responsible for designing, maintaining, and operating 3D printers used in construction. 2. Building Maintenance Manager (20%): These professionals manage the day-to-day operations of building maintenance, ensuring that 3D printed buildings are functioning optimally and safely. 3. Senior CAD Technician (15%): Skilled in Computer-Aided Design (CAD) software, these technicians create detailed designs for 3D printed building components, bridges, and other infrastructure. 4. BIM Coordinator (10%): Building Information Modeling (BIM) coordinators manage digital models of buildings and ensure effective collaboration between various stakeholders in the construction process. 5. Facility Manager (10%): They are responsible for the efficient and safe operation of buildings and grounds, ensuring the longevity and functionality of 3D printed structures. 6. Material Scientist (10%): Material scientists research, develop, and test new materials suitable for 3D printing, enabling the creation of more durable and sustainable buildings. 7. Construction Project Manager (10%): These managers oversee the entire construction process, including planning, coordinating, and executing 3D printing projects for building maintenance and repair.
